To convert fluid ounces to cups, divide the volume by the conversion ratio. Since one cup is equal to 8 fluid ounces, you can use this simple formula to convert: cups = fluid ounces ÷ 8 Here is the math and the answer to "48 oz to cups?": 48 x 0.125 = 6. 48 oz = 6 cups. You may also be interested to know that 1 oz is 1/8 of a cup. Thus, you can divide 48 by 8 to get the same answer. Cup (US) Definition: A cup is a unit of volume in the imperial and United States customary systems of measurement. The metric cup is defined as 250 milliliters. One United States customary cup is equal to 236.5882365 milliliters as well as 1/16 U.S. customary gallons, 8 U.S. customary fluid ounces, 16 U.S. customary tablespoons, or 48 U.S. customary teaspoons.
